essentially crash-landed in a cocoon of airbags and one soft-landed. The first lander‚ Sojourner‚ part of the mars pathfinder mission‚ was the size of a milk crate and weighed 33 pounds. It landed using airbags on July 4‚ 1997‚ and stayed active 10 times longer than scheduled. The next missions were the twin rovers Spirit and Opportunity‚ which were launched a few weeks apart and landed on opposite sides of the planet in the summer of 2003‚ also using airbag technology. force acting on it for a certain amount of time; this results in the change of momentum. The impulse can be found by the equation‚ Impulse=Force x Time. The most common use of impulse is used with the car airbag system. The airbags in cars work to reduce the damage to the people involved. The airbag works to increase the time needed to stop the momentum of the individual in the car. If the time is increased‚ the force of impact will decrease. Good: Cars Mercedes –Benz CLS-Class *Features‚ attributes‚ functions: Mercedes-Benz has put all of its latest safety features into the CLS-class. In addition to front airbags‚ there are side-impact airbags in the front seats and side curtain airbags throughout. The car features a "smart" sensor system for the seatbelts and airbags that can detect and react to accident severity. Micro Electro-Mechanical Systems Micro Electro-Mechanical Systems (MEMS) is the integration of mechanical elements‚ sensors‚ actuators and electronics on a common silicon substrate using microfabrication techniques. MEMS are a hot area of research because they integrate sensing‚ analyzing and responding on the same silicon substrate hence promising realization of complete systems-on-a-chip.
